Why Is Night Vision Essential for Android Security Cameras?
Night vision is essential for Android security cameras to capture clear images in low-light conditions. This feature enhances surveillance effectiveness during nighttime or in poorly lit areas.
According to the National Institute of Justice, night vision technology allows users to observe and record activities when natural light is insufficient. This enhances security measures during dark hours when security threats often increase.
Several reasons underscore the importance of night vision in security cameras. Firstly, many criminal activities occur after sunset, making visibility crucial for crime prevention. Secondly, accurate surveillance during nighttime helps in identifying suspects and recording evidence. Thirdly, night vision capability improves overall security system reliability, leading to increased peace of mind for users.
Night vision uses infrared (IR) technology to illuminate dark areas. Infrared light is invisible to the naked eye but can be detected by special sensors in security cameras. This technology allows cameras to work effectively in complete darkness or at minimal light levels.
The functioning mechanism involves emitting infrared light, which reflects off objects and is captured by the camera’s sensor. This process generates a clear image in low-light conditions. Different types of night vision include passive night vision, which amplifies existing light, and active night vision, which uses infrared illumination.
Specific conditions that enhance the need for night vision include urban areas with poor street lighting, residential neighborhoods, and outdoor spaces with minimal illumination. For example, a security camera placed in a dimly lit parking lot can monitor movements and deter potential theft effectively, enhancing overall security without additional lighting.

How Do You Ensure Optimal Placement for Your Android Security Camera?
To ensure optimal placement for your Android security camera, consider factors like field of view, location, height, light exposure, and connectivity. Each factor contributes significantly to the camera’s effectiveness.
-
Field of view: The camera should cover the desired area. A camera with a wider lens can capture more area. Many models offer viewing angles ranging from 90 to 180 degrees. Choose a lens suitable for your monitoring needs.
-
Location: Install the camera in strategic places. Common locations include entrances, backyards, driveways, and common areas. Placing the camera near entry points enhances security by capturing any potential intruders.
-
Height: Install the camera at an appropriate height. A height of 8 to 10 feet is generally recommended to avoid easy tampering while providing an adequate view of the area. This height also helps reduce obstructions.
-
Light exposure: Avoid placing the camera in direct sunlight or bright artificial light. Excessive brightness can produce glare, leading to image distortion. Position the camera in shaded areas where it can capture clear footage without interference.
-
Connectivity: Ensure a strong Wi-Fi connection for the camera. A weak signal can lead to interruptions in video streaming and recording. Use network extenders if necessary to enhance the connection quality for remote access and control.
By paying attention to these factors, you can significantly enhance the effectiveness and reliability of your Android security camera system in monitoring your environment.
